- [ ] **Font vendoring sign-off (Orvenmark Type Bundle).** Before the ceremony proceeds, confirm the vendored third-party fonts in the Larkfield release tree match the checksums recorded in the custody ledger. The release manager verifies license files are bundled alongside each typeface and that no upstream mirror was consulted after the freeze date. Once both witnesses initial the ledger, seal the font archive with the ceremony key. The archive's recovery passphrase is recorded below.

recovery phrase for bajeg-kagug: gilax-belael-frador-rusath-oliiel-belix-julox-druok-siliel-casion-casox-fenir-giliel-fraok

Ticket #4821: Validator plugin sandbox rejects all third-party schemas in staging. Root cause: the Fluxgate plugin loader on the staging cluster was pointed at the production registry, so externally authored validators fail signature checks. Plugin authors targeting the Fluxgate SDK should not change their manifests; this is an environment issue on our side. To reproduce locally, copy the staging env template and add the registry signing secret on the line below.

sealed setting: ARCHIVE_KEY3=8d0

**Ticket QRM-4182: Upgrade Fernwick broker from 3.2 to 4.0**

For the weekly sync: the Fernwick message broker upgrade is staged on the Larkspur cluster. We've verified consumer offset migration, replayed two days of traffic without loss, and confirmed the new ack semantics don't break the Pondside billing workers. Remaining risk is the TLS handshake change; Maribel is testing mixed-version failover tonight. Rollback snapshot is retained for 72 hours. The canary build that passed all soak tests is identified below.

pipeline stamp: htk3_69f